Today, another highlight from the eligible case studies submitted for the #OpenResearch Award.
👉 Increasing the #academic value and recognition of the #European #Law #Blog
🔗 https://www.europeanlawblog.eu/
Legal blogs like the European Law Blog (ELB) are invaluable for staying updated on #EU law developments.
The Editorial Board:
• Established a #NonProfit foundation;
• Redesigned ELB’s platform;
• Assigned DOIs to posts;
• Adopted a CC BY #OpenAccess license.

Aberdeen's University Librarian @simonjbains announced our new rights retention policy today!
Seems niche, but is super important for fighting the supervillains in for-profit publishing.
Uni staff can no longer be made to sign over copyright to publish. All work will be made freely available to all in the university repository.
